Takamatsu Port is located on the Seto Inland Sea, which was one of Japan’s first recognized national parks. Setouchi, with its blue water and lush islands, is considered one of Japan’s most beautiful regions. Cruises departing from Takamatsu Port travel along the Seto Ohashi Bridge, the world’s longest road and railway bridge that runs along the picturesque archipelago, linking the islands’ culture and arts while also connecting Shikoku and Honshu. Takamatsu Port serves as a terminal, giving access to numerous locations via boats, trains, and buses, making it a hub for social activity.

Overview of Takamatsu Port Cruise

Takamatsu Cruise Port is a well-developed regional cruise port in western Japan, located on the northeastern coast of Shikoku Island facing the Seto Inland Sea. The port is a popular stop for international and domestic cruise ships, serving as a gateway to Shikoku’s cultural heritage, scenic islands, and traditional Japanese gardens. Takamatsu is especially known for its calm waters and easy access to nearby art islands.

What are the Port of Takamatsu Cruise Terminals?

The Port of Takamatsu in Japan, a key gateway to the Seto Inland Sea, functions as a cruise port, primarily utilizing facilities within the redeveloped Sunport Takamatsu area, which includes waterfront promenades, shopping centers like the Maritime Plaza, and the Symbol Tower, serving as a convenient hub for tourists exploring Kagawa Prefecture and nearby islands like Naoshima and Shodoshima. While not featuring a singular, massive international cruise terminal like some major global ports, it offers docks and passenger services for cruise vessels and ferries, connecting to Shikoku’s attractions and island hopping.
